About MeI started learning the piano at the age of three. I obtained Grade 8 (ABRSM) piano at the age of twelve and was awarded the Dorothy Fryer prize for the highest marks at this level. I graduated from the Toho Gakuen Music School in Tokyo with a degree in piano performance and a degree in teaching music. I studied with Professor Benjamin Kaplan in London who is a distinguished concert pianist. I have performed on NHK television in Japan and given concerts in Britain including the Greig Piano Concerto with the Peterborough Symphony Orchestra in 2004. I currently teach at Oundle School as well as offering private piano lessons. |
